Specifications of Oukitel WP23
The display of Oukitel WP23 measures 6.52 inches with IPS LCD technology. Peak brightness reaches 400 nits for excellent outdoor visibility. The screen renders at 720x1600 pixels resolution.
The camera system of Oukitel WP23 features 2 rear cameras: 13 main, 2MP ultrawide. Video recording supports up to 1080p.
The battery of Oukitel WP23 has 10600mAh capacity with 18 wired charging. A full charge takes approximately 240 min minutes.
The performance of Oukitel WP23 is powered by the MediaTek Helio P35 MT6765 chipset with PowerVR GE8320 GPU.
The memory of Oukitel WP23 offers 4GB RAM with 64GB storage options. RAM uses LPDDR3 technology. Storage is 64GB 4GB RAM.
The connectivity of Oukitel WP23 includes Wi-Fi Yes, and Bluetooth 5.0. NFC is supported for contactless payments.
The build of Oukitel WP23 weighs 373g with Plastic frame and Textured back. Water and dust resistance is rated IP68.
The software of Oukitel WP23 runs Android 13. Software support extends 2 years through 2028.
